titleOfInvention | Photosensitive material developer and photosensitive material developing method |
abstract | PROBLEM TO BE SOLVED: To provide a developer for a photosensitive material capable of forming a good image without causing stain on an image formed even when a photosensitive material is developed in a large amount, and having excellent image reproducibility. It is to provide. A developer for a photosensitive material, comprising a compound represented by the following general formula (1). [Chemical 1] [Wherein R 1 and R 2 represent a hydrogen atom, an alkyl group or an alkenyl group having 1 to 22 carbon atoms, n represents an integer of 1 to 20, M represents an alkali metal cation, an ammonium cation or an amine cation.
